A collet is a segmented sleeve, band or collar that clamps a workpiece or a tool with a taper. Learn about different kinds of collets, such as external, internal, scroll, pin and ER collets, and how they are used in metalworking and machine tools.

Understanding Collet Types ER Collets: One of the most widely used types, ER collets are versatile and commonly employed in milling, drilling, and CNC machines. They offer a good clamping range and are known for their precision and flexibility. TG Collets: TG collets, or "Tight Grip" collets, are primarily used for heavy-duty machining tasks.
